What should a consulting cover letter include?

When applying for a job as a consultant, your cover letter should include your career history and key accomplishments, as well as providing a glimpse into your personality. If you do not have previous consulting experience, highlight relevant projects completed in college or graduate school.

What does BCG look for in candidates?

BCG describes ideal candidates as “passionate, open-minded individuals” with “curiosity to ask the right questions, the courage and creativity to blaze new paths, the ability to collaborate with colleagues and clients, and the leadership skills to transform your ideas into action.”

What’s more important education or experience?

When a job is hard to fill, employers are more likely to overlook the lack of a degree when candidates have sufficient experience in place of the “right” education. And in large organizations (those with more than 10,000 employees), experience is more important than a degree 44% of the time.

Is experience equivalent to a degree?

Work experience, in many cases, can be substituted for required college degrees. For example, in the Administrative Management career fields, 3 years of general work experience can be substituted for a 4-year course of study leading to a bachelor’s degree.

What is equivalent experience?

When an employer mentions “equivalent experience” in a job posting, it can either mean experience in place of some educational requirements or non-paid experience. For example, a job announcement may state a required certification or a college degree or some defined experience in the field.

Does a bachelor degree count as experience?

“Experience” typically refers to employment. “Job requires BS and 3 years experience with java” could mean the three years you spent with java in school could count. However, that too often means professional experience with X technology. So unfortunately, a degree doesn’t equal 4 years of experience.
